Warriors sign free agent G Nate Robinson

OAKLAND, Calif. (AP) — The Golden State Warriors have signed free agent Nate Robinson, adding another flashy but undersized point guard to a backcourt that already features Monta Ellis and Stephen Curry.

The Warriors announced the move before Wednesday night’s game at San Antonio. Robinson will be in uniform and wear No. 2 when Golden State plays at the Los Angeles Lakers on Friday night.

The 5-foot-9, three-time NBA Slam Dunk champion is expected to provide depth at the guard spot as Curry already has sprained his troublesome, surgically repaired right ankle twice this season. Robinson appeared in only four games and three playoff appearances last season with Oklahoma City after Boston traded him away.

His release from Oklahoma City was announced Dec. 24.
